更新:2007 年 11 月
通过设置 Dock 属性,可以使控件与窗体边缘对齐。此属性指定控件在窗体中的驻留位置。可以将 Dock 属性设置为下列值:
| 设置 | 控件上的效果 | 
|---|---|
| 停靠到窗体底部。 | |
| 占据窗体中的所有剩余空间。 | |
| 停靠到窗体的左侧。 | |
| 不停靠在任何位置,而是显示在 Location 属性指定的位置。 | |
| 停靠到窗体的右侧。 | |
| 停靠到窗体的顶部。 | 
在 Visual Studio 中,对此功能提供设计时支持。
在运行时设置控件的 Dock 属性
- 可在代码中将 Dock 属性设置为适当的值。 - ' To set the Dock property internally. Me.Dock = DockStyle.Top ' To set the Dock property from another object. UserControl1.Dock = DockStyle.Top- // To set the Dock property internally. this.Dock = DockStyle.Top; // To set the Dock property from another object. UserControl1.Dock = DockStyle.Top;- // To set the Dock property internally. this.set_Dock(DockStyle.Top); // To set the Dock property from another object. UserControl1.set_Dock(DockStyle.Top);
请参见
任务
如何:在 FlowLayoutPanel 控件中锚定和停靠子控件
如何:在 TableLayoutPanel 控件中锚定和停靠子控件